Audi SQ5


Audi SQ5 brings diesel power to S-line crossover

Audi chose Le Mans weekend to unveil the newest and sportiest model in the Q5 range. The Audi SQ5 has 20-inch wheels, a lowered sport suspension, an Alcantara-swathed interior and diesel power under the hood.
Enthusiasts need not despair, though. Audi has fitted the SQ5 with a 3.0-liter, twin-turbocharged V6 diesel that churns out 313 hp and 479 lb-ft of torque. This is also the first diesel to grace Audi's S line of performance vehicles.

Audi claims that the SQ5 TDI will run from standstill to 62 mph in 5.1 seconds and return up to 32 mpg. We suspect achieving both of those numbers at the same time is highly unlikely.

An eight-speed automatic transmission is standard, as is Audi's quattro all-wheel-drive system.

Inside, the appointments are typical Audi S line, with aluminum accents and a liberal smattering of S badges.

While the SQ5 TDI will be hitting European showrooms at the beginning of 2013, there's no word on whether it will be coming stateside. Those wanting a sporty Audi SUV in the United States will have to “settle” for the S line trim of the Q7 and its 333-hp supercharged gasoline V6.
